Tayce, queen of Ru Paul's Drag Race UK, teaches us a thing or two about makeup, the importance of face tape and how video games might be the key to mindfulness



She’s known for her savage lip-sync battles and captivating energy on RuPaul’s Drag Race UK, and although she didn’t quite win first place on the show, Welsh queen Tayce has certainly won our hearts.

With her diamond encrusted, bold makeup looks and perfectly contoured skin, we thought we’d hit up the star for her top beauty hacks, skincare tricks and wellness tips from her first experience with makeup and her everyday go-to routine to how she looks after her skin and how she cares for that show-stopping smile.

“Makeup has been in my life for as long as I can remember”

I used to mess up all my mum’s makeup from when I was four years old and basically destroying everything! I remember taking the eye pencils and cracking them, smearing lipstick all over my teeth. Make up has been in my life for as long as I can remember.

“If my highlight can’t be seen from space, I’m staying in”

If I’m not in drag I don’t really wear makeup, when I’m wearing it, it’s very full on. I like a full coverage foundation, a poppin’ highlight, a strong brow and I like a good pigment on the eye. The vibe is very runway, and usually a nice bold lip that shows off my nice white nashers.

Having said that, I like to switch up all the time. I don’t like to get stagnant with my looks. I do a red lip a couple of times a week then I switch it up and do a brown lip but I would say a strong popping highlight so my cheekbones can be seen from space, and if not, I ain’t going out baby!

“Face tape is my biggest makeup hack”


I love a face tape. Can’t live without it. I like yanking my face right back and making myself look about two years old. I used to use gorilla tape but now I’ve upgraded to the pro stuff.

Oh, and another hack is if you smudge your mascara when applying it, let it dry before your try and remove it. If it’s wet, it’s going to go all over the place, but if you leave it to dry and you can just scrape it off with your nail and you’re good to go.

“My skincare routine extends to my teeth”

I do love a bit of skincare. It all starts with a lot of cleansing, toning, exfoliating, serums, oils, moisturisers. It’s all about celebrating the skin, it’s nothing to do with makeup, it’s about your good serums your oils, massaging in your face, lymphatic drainage, all that good stuff.

I also treat my gums and teeth with the same level of care as I do my skin. I’m currently using Colgate Elixir Gum Booster as it has hyaluronic acid to make sure they’re hydrated and healthy.
